Transaction 80590ea5071a97bbca0f93487e251128fd4fb53ba913430c7310f30a26346ec4

block
787b13e91d480317bbe5bc264b3b90360e58235c9dd14f6c2c4d085150db1fbd

1 Input

21 Outputs